Understanding the Critical Role of a VPN in Modern Digital Life
In an era where cyber threats are increasing, safeguarding your sensitive details has never been more crucial. A VPN scrambles your online activity, ensuring that cybercriminals, ISPs, and third parties cannot monitor your online behavior. Whether you’re using public Wi-Fi at a coffee shop or handling confidential files, a VPN acts as an invisible barrier against information theft.
People ignore the dangers of open connections, putting at risk their financial details, passwords, and message histories. Advanced VPN Features to Enhance Your Security
Modern VPNs provide cutting-edge options that surpass standard protection. A network blocker terminates all internet traffic if the VPN fails, avoiding data exposure. Double VPN routes your connection through several nodes, hiding your internet footprint more effectively.
Tracker prevention tools remove intrusive ads and halt phishing sites. Split tunneling lets you choose which apps use the VPN, balancing performance and protection. For teams, fixed locations and user management facilitate encrypted communication.
Addressing Common Myths About VPNs
Despite their popularity, many users misunderstand how VPNs operate. A common myth is that VPNs entirely anonymize your internet usage. While they mask your location, browser fingerprints can still reveal your identity. Additionally, few VPNs adhere to zero-data retention rules, so researching your provider’s standards is vital.
A second fallacy is that VPNs significantly slow network performance. While security measures adds overhead, top-tier tools lessen this impact website with high-speed networks. Lastly, unpaid tools often sacrifice privacy by selling user data or showing intrusive ads.
